What Percent Of Motorcycle Accidents Are Fatal

By | July 26, 2021



Motorcycle accidents are one of the leading causes of death and serious injury across the country. While the risk of a fatal crash is greater for motorcyclists than for other vehicles, many safety measures can be taken to minimize this risk and make riding safer. So, what percent of motorcycle accidents are fatal?

According to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A), motorcyclists are almost 28 times more likely than passenger car occupants to die in an accident. In fact, out of all the motorcycle fatalities in 2019, only 18% of the riders were wearing a helmet at the time of the crash. This statistic is important to consider when considering how much risk is associated with riding a motorcycle.

In addition to the dangers posed by not wearing a helmet, motorcyclists are also at risk of suffering severe injuries even when wearing a helmet due to the nature of the vehicles. Compared to larger, more stable cars and trucks, motorcycles lack the stability and protection that comes from having four wheels and a solid frame. Even a minor incident can result in catastrophic injuries, making it critical for riders to practice safe riding habits.

In conclusion, motorcycle fatalities make up a significant portion of all traffic-related fatalities in the United States. While this percentage is alarming, it underscores the importance of taking the necessary precautions when operating a motorcycle, such as wearing a helmet, following the speed limit, and avoiding distractions. By following these guidelines, riders can help reduce their risk of becoming a statistic.
